public class EntityNotFoundException
- extends PersistenceException
The EntityNotFoundException is thrown by the persistence provider when an
entity reference obtained by getReference is accessed but the entity does not
exist. It is also thrown by the refresh operation when the entity no longer
exists in the database. The current transaction, if one is active, will be
marked for rollback.

EntityNotFoundException
public EntityNotFoundException()
- Default constructor : builds an exception with an empty message.
EntityNotFoundException
public EntityNotFoundException(String message)
- Build an exception with the given message.
- Parameters:
message - the given message to use.
